Tomato Gruyère Melts

Add a simple green salad to our updated version of the grilled cheese sandwich, and dinner is served.

Recipe information

  • Total Time

    30 minutes

  • Yield

    Serves 2

Ingredients

2 English muffins, split
1 large beefsteak tomato, cut into 4 (3/4-inch-thick) slices and seeded
1 cup coarsely grated Gruyère (4 ounces)
1/4 cup chopped fresh basil
2 tablespoons dry bread crumbs
2 small garlic cloves, minced

Preparation

  1. Step 1

    Preheat oven to 375°F.

    Step 2

    Toast muffins until golden. Put 1 slice tomato on top of each muffin half and season with salt and pepper. Bake on a baking sheet in middle of oven until tomatoes are softened, 17 to 20 minutes.

    Step 3

    Stir together cheese, basil, bread crumbs, and garlic and season with salt and pepper. Mound cheese mixture on top of tomatoes and bake until melted, about 5 minutes.
